From: Peter Seebach Date: Wed, 9 May 2012 20:14:41 +0000 (-0500) Subject: sanity.bbclass: Detect empty $PATH components too X-Git-Tag: 2015-4~10672 X-Git-Url: https://code.ossystems.io/gitweb?a=commitdiff_plain;h=ac4201b714c83c614113bfa735d0a2fc6f64db99;p=openembedded-core.git sanity.bbclass: Detect empty $PATH components too Empty components in $PATH have the same effect as a . in $PATH, and are a common side-effect of inserting a misspelled or unset shell variable in $PATH.
